Biography

Heidi Wessman Kneale was born in one of the United States. She spent much of her youth in creative pursuits from music and theatre to sewing and painting and, of course, writing.

Her first publication was a Fantasy poem in a literary magazine in 1989.

While she loves science dearly and originally majored in Biology (genetics), eventually her love of Fine Arts won her over and she earned her BA in Film and Music.

Later she moved to Australia where she continues to pursue those things she loves best.

She writes non-fiction of all kinds and fiction, primarily Science Fiction & Fantasy and Romance, with occasional forays into Horror. Novels are her favourite form to write, though they take an awfully long time. She has written novels, novellas, short stories, musicals, plays, screenplays, non-fiction articles, non-fiction books, paid blogs, web copy and more.

A member of the Online Writing Workshop since its inception in the early 1990's, she pursues the excellence of writing through improving her skills and collecting tools of the craft. Currently she is a Journeyman Writer.
